To make an epsom salt bath, dissolve about 1 to 1.5 cups of epsom salt in warm water (not hot) before adding your baby or child to the tub. Stir gently to fully dissolve the salt. Keep bath time short—around 10 to 15 minutes—to avoid drying out sensitive skin. Afterward, pat the area dry carefully and apply a gentle, antifungal diaper cream or hydrocortisone ointment if recommended by a pediatrician. Rinse thoroughly to remove all salt before dressing.

Always use lukewarm water and limit bath duration to prevent irritation. Test a small area of skin first if sensitivity is a concern. Avoid adding essential oils or additives unless recommended by a healthcare provider. For persistent or severe rash, consult a pediatrician to rule out other conditions. Pairing epsom salt baths with breathable, cotton diapers and frequent changes enhances overall care and reduces recurrence.
